Output 674ef881e565d4cce6fa5e96db10b10255a4faa2a2c1014cde7042d6c082b887:16

value
59384725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07c4f9f176b89d587210db25d94a1f33b19b0844 OP_EQUAL
address
M8cEvvqheaCt5aP3g1YfjRpZbwhQCxDNpd
transaction
674ef881e565d4cce6fa5e96db10b10255a4faa2a2c1014cde7042d6c082b887
spent
true